Dignitaries Celebrate Rev. Dr. Ndukuba's 65th Birthday

Dignitaries Celebrate Rev. Dr. Ndukuba's 65th Birthday

Darius Ishaku, the former governor of Taraba State, Emeka Ihedioha, the former governor of Imo State, and Titi Abubakar, wife of former Vice President Atiku Abubakar, celebrated Rev. Dr.

Henri Ndukuba, the Primate of the Anglican Communion Nigeria, on his 65th birthday during a thanksgiving service held at the Cathedral Church of the Advent Life Camp in Gwarimpa, Abuja. The event included the unveiling of Ndukuba's new book and was attended by dignitaries such as former Inspector General of Police Sunday Ehindero and former Anglican Primate Nicholas Okoh.

During the service, Ndukuba expressed gratitude for his life and ministry, stating he felt energized despite advancing age. He urged leaders to embrace humility and selfless service, emphasizing that true leadership reflects the example of Jesus Christ.

The celebration featured prayers and tributes highlighting Ndukuba's impact on leadership and church development in Nigeria.
